This position supports the financial coordination and reimbursement processes for transplant services by evaluating coverage securing authorizations and facilitating access to funding sources. It serves as a key liaison between patients clinical teams payers and revenue cycle departments to ensure timely and accurate financial clearance. The role requires strong knowledge of healthcare reimbursement insurance contracts and regulatory programs to support optimal financial outcomes. It also involves providing patient-centered financial guidance while supporting departmental goals and maintaining compliance with organizational and payer requirements.
Identifies trends that may indicate problem areas and alerts leadership. Plays a key role in identifying and implementing solutions and ongoing monitoring of outcomes.
